Preface

This volume represents the seventh edition of the ECOOP Workshop Reader, a compendium of workshop reports from the 17th European Conference on ObjectOriented Programming (ECOOP 2003), held in Darmstadt, Germany, during July 21–25, 2003. The workshops were held during the first two days of the conference. They cover a wide range of interesting and innovative topics in object-oriented technology and offered the participants an opportunity for interaction and lively discussion.
